What is the only complete circular cartilage of the larynx?

a. Arytenoid
b. Corniculate
c. Cricoid
d. Thyroid


ANS: C
Just below the thyroid cartilage is the cricoid cartilage, which is the only laryngeal structure that forms a complete ring of cartilage around the airway and is the narrowest region of the upper airway in infants.
